Garage Door and Gate Painting Technical Details Worth Knowing

Below is the technical depth that separates a finish that holds for a decade from one that rusts through in two.

Zinc-rich primer on metal substrates

Steel and iron substrates need rust-blocking primer that contains metallic zinc - the zinc particles sacrifice themselves galvanically before the underlying steel can rust. Cheap latex primer over metal forms a film but doesn't stop oxidation chemically. Zinc-rich primer (Rust-Oleum Zinc Clad, SW Pro Industrial Pro-Cryl, or equivalent) is the right product on every metal gate and steel garage door.

DTM (direct-to-metal) coating technology

DTM coatings are formulated for metal substrates - they bond directly to clean metal without a separate primer in some cases, and they flex with metal expansion/contraction without cracking. SW DTM Acrylic and Pro Industrial Multi-Surface are our defaults. Standard wall paint applied to metal cracks at the panel seams within 18 months because it can't flex with the metal.

Rust treatment - wire brush vs chemical

Surface rust: hand-wire-brush or sand to bare metal, then prime. Pitted rust or rust scale: chemical rust converter (phosphoric acid-based) chemically converts iron oxide to iron phosphate, then prime. Heavy rust through-and-through: substrate replacement, not repair. We assess and choose the right approach at the walk.

Wrought iron brush technique

Wrought iron with scrollwork detail can't be rolled - rollers cover the front faces but miss the back sides and intricate detail. Specialty angle brushes 1 to 1.5 inches wide, plus detail brushes for inside-curve work, are the only way to get full coverage. Time-consuming compared to spraying but spray overspray on iron gates often ends up on adjacent stucco walls and landscaping.

Garage door panel sequencing

Garage doors have horizontal panel seams that need clean paint lines. We paint top panel down so drips from upper panels can be brushed into lower panels before drying. Seams masked carefully and painted as a continuous surface. Brush + roll method gives smoother finish than spray on garage doors because spray overspray ends up on hardware and tracks.

Fiberglass garage door spec

Fiberglass-faced garage doors need an adhesion-promoting primer designed for slick substrates - standard wood-trim primer fails on fiberglass within months. Bonding primers like Zinsser BIN, SW Multi-Purpose Bonding, or Rust-Oleum Bonding Primer give the topcoat something to grip. We choose per manufacturer guidance on the specific door.

Local Conditions That Drive Garage Door and Gate Paint Failure

South Florida is one of the most aggressive metal-coating environments in the country. The seven items below come up on most projects.

South Florida sun on south-facing garage doors

Direct UV on a south- or west-facing garage door breaks down standard exterior pigments faster than any wall surface. Deep colors (navy, deep red, charcoal) fade first. UV-stable acrylic urethane or alkyd-modified topcoats hold color for five to seven years on direct-sun surfaces.

Salt-air corrosion on coastal hardware

Coral Gables waterfront, Coconut Grove, Key Biscayne, Surfside homes within five miles of the coast see hinges, knobs, and decorative hardware corrode within months of standard repaint. Stainless or solid-brass hardware upgrades during refinish are worth the cost.

Hurricane wind on entry gates

Tropical storm and hurricane winds put pressure on entry gates that other regions don't see. Gates that aren't properly anchored bend at the hinge during storms; paint flexes and cracks at the stress points. We don't fix structural issues but we do inspect for them.

Wrought iron Mediterranean Revival pattern in Coral Gables

Coral Gables, Coconut Grove, and older Miami Beach homes often have ornate wrought iron entry gates with scrollwork detail. These need hand-brushed refinishing with rust-blocking primer at every weld point - rollers miss the welds, and skipped welds bleed rust within a year.

Rebar corrosion in older garage door frames

Older Hialeah and Hialeah Gardens homes with concrete garage door frames sometimes show rebar corrosion at the frame edge that bleeds rust onto the garage door paint. We treat the frame rebar first if visible, then paint.

Can you paint my wrought iron gate?
Yes - rust-blocking zinc primer plus DTM topcoat. Hand-brushed detail work on every spindle, scroll, and weld. Standard wall paint on iron gates fails within 18 months; we use the right products.
Do you treat rust before painting?
Yes - rust treatment is included in standard scope. Surface rust hand-wire-brushed to bare metal. Pitted rust gets a chemical rust converter. Heavy rust through-and-through gets a substrate replacement conversation.
Will the new paint hold up in salt air on my coastal home?
Yes with proper spec - UV-stable acrylic urethane or alkyd-modified DTM topcoat plus zinc-rich primer. Stainless or brass hardware upgrade recommended on coastal homes. Standard wall paint will not hold up.
